May Deep Stack Flashback: Lindemulder Wins $67K in 2017 Edition

Level 12 : 1,000/2,000, 2,000 ante
Ben Lindemulder (Image: Seminole Hard Rock)
Ben Lindemulder (Image: Seminole Hard Rock)

Two years ago, this very event attracted 1,029 entries to the Seminole Hard Rock Hotel & Casino, which created a $308,700 prize pool. In the end, it was 27-year-old Ben Lindemulder emerging victorious to capture a $67,232 first-place prize plus a $1,650 seat into the Deepest Stack event.

Lindemulder, originally from Grand Rapids, Michigan, resides in Pompano Beach where he is self-employed. It marked his third tournament cash in Hollywood, first victory and largest career score.
